In January President Trump fired Biden-appointed Democrat chair of the National Labor Relations Board Gwynne Wilcox and the general counsel of the board.
Trump’s decision to fire pro-union members Gwynne Wilcox and the labor board’s general counsel Jennifer Abruzzo got pushback from the agency and was described as an “unprecedented and illegal” move.
Last month US District Judge Beryl Howell, an Obama appointee, ruled Trump’s firing of Gwynne Wilcox was unlawful.
In a shocking 36-page opinion reviewed by The Gateway Pundit last week, Judge Beryl Howell compared Trump to a “king” or “dictator” and said the president does not have the authority to terminate members of the National Labor Relations Board.
Judge Howell claimed Wilcox’s job falls under “Humphrey’s Executor.”
“The Supreme Court explicitly upheld removal restrictions for such boards when considering removal protections for the commissioners of the FTC in Humphrey’s Executor in 1935, while also recognizing the President’s general authority over removal of executive branch officials,” Beryl Howell wrote.
The Trump DOJ fought back and the DC Circuit Court of Appeals late last month agreed that President Trump indeed has the authority to fire them without cause.
The three judge panel on the DC Circuit Court: Henderson (George W. Bush appointee), Millett (Obama appointee), and Walker (Trump appointee) sided with President Trump on Friday in a 2-1 vote and ordered the DOJ motions for stay be granted.
However, Wilcox asked the court’s entire slate of judges to weigh in (en banc) and the court voted 7-4 to reinstate her.
Although the full Supreme Court did not weigh in on the merits of the Wilcox and Cathy Harris case yet, Justice Clarence Thomas previously blasted the 1935 decision known as Humphrey’s Executor.
“Humphrey’s Executor poses a direct threat to our constitutional structure and, as a result, the liberty of the American people . . . Our tolerance of independent agencies in Humphrey’s Executor is an unfortunate example of the Court’s failure to apply the Constitution as written. That decision has paved the way for an ever-expanding encroachment on the power of the Executive, contrary to our constitutional design,” Justice Thomas wrote.
